靳智豪,顧金龍,徐 俊,俞炳良,萬文濤
(吉利汽車集團(tuán)有限公司,浙江 寧波 315300)
繼德國提出工業(yè)4.0之后,我國于2015年提出了《中國制造2025》計劃,在這份計劃中,智能制造工程作為五大工程之一被提出。自此,在國內(nèi)汽車制造行業(yè),智能化、自動化設(shè)備開始作為新技術(shù)被研究,并逐漸推廣。當(dāng)前在汽車裝配的沖壓車間、焊接車間、噴涂車間,自動化普及率較高,并傾向智能化發(fā)展,而在零部件裝配車間,仍采用較多的人員作業(yè),在設(shè)備投入上,自動化智能化投入程度較低。本文將著重介紹總裝車間在車輛質(zhì)量控制方面所研究,并推廣應(yīng)用的外觀質(zhì)量視覺自動化檢查系統(tǒng)及應(yīng)用案例。
傳統(tǒng)控制方法有以下幾點:
(1)待檢查車輛行至檢查工位;
(2)檢查人員從車內(nèi)拿出檢查事項紙質(zhì)清單,然后確認(rèn)車輛配置;
(3)確認(rèn)車輛配置所要求的差異件、個性化定制件信息;
(4)依照檢查事項紙質(zhì)清單中所要求的順序、檢查項開展檢查工作;
(5)在檢查事項紙質(zhì)清單上記錄過程檢查結(jié)果及最終檢查結(jié)果;
(6)交付檢查車輛然后開始下一輪的檢查工作。
視覺檢查系統(tǒng)控制方法有以下幾點:
(1)待檢查車輛行至檢查工位;
(2)上層制造企業(yè)生產(chǎn)過程執(zhí)行系統(tǒng)(Manufacturing Execution System, MES)推送車型配置信息給智能化檢查設(shè)備(此系統(tǒng)預(yù)留與MES系統(tǒng)互聯(lián)端口);
(3)待檢車輛行至信息采集點,觸發(fā)光電開關(guān),光電開關(guān)發(fā)送信息給檢查設(shè)備;
(4)設(shè)備啟動前、后、左、右、上等5個攝像頭對檢查區(qū)域進(jìn)行拍照;
(5)從數(shù)據(jù)庫中調(diào)取檢查零部件正確的配置圖片及其它信息;
(6)提取整車照片中的待檢零部件外觀、顏色等信息與數(shù)據(jù)庫信息進(jìn)行對比、判斷;
(7)對檢查結(jié)果通過工位顯示屏及聲光報警器進(jìn)行顯示(OK/NG采用不同的警示、顯示、音樂提醒等);
(8)檢查結(jié)果(OK/NG)上傳MES系統(tǒng)進(jìn)行存檔(檢查數(shù)據(jù)要可查、可導(dǎo)出)并開始下一輪的檢查工作。
圖1是視覺檢查系統(tǒng)的架構(gòu)模型,此系統(tǒng)由硬件控制系統(tǒng)、軟件控制系統(tǒng)、視覺系統(tǒng)和機械架構(gòu)等部分構(gòu)成。
視覺檢查系統(tǒng)網(wǎng)絡(luò)模型架構(gòu)如圖2所示,主要包括輸入層、應(yīng)用層、輸出層。
輸入層:用戶通過機械臂夾持視覺系統(tǒng)多角度、多維度采集工件待測區(qū)域圖片,采集后的圖像存入圖像數(shù)據(jù)庫。
應(yīng)用層:采集圖像導(dǎo)入后,進(jìn)行相關(guān)項目檢測。系統(tǒng)通過調(diào)用應(yīng)用層的功能、協(xié)議、查詢工具等進(jìn)行一系列圖像分析,并針對每一次工件測試,導(dǎo)出測試分析報告。針對不同用戶(操作員、系統(tǒng)維護(hù)員、算法開發(fā)人員),設(shè)定不同權(quán)限。
輸出層:針對每次工件測試,輸出測試結(jié)果(合格/不合格),并在相應(yīng)位置做出標(biāo)記。根據(jù)測試結(jié)果,確定工件方向及處理意見。工件在經(jīng)過人工處理/復(fù)檢后,進(jìn)行二次檢測。
視覺檢查系統(tǒng)設(shè)備需求如表1所示。
視覺系統(tǒng)具備以下功能模塊,可以實現(xiàn)如下功能,如表2所示。
3.1.1 工控機
在視覺檢查系統(tǒng)中,該工控機的控制原理:當(dāng)車輛由傳送帶傳送到檢測位置時,傳感器發(fā)送信號給工控機,同時,工控機給相機發(fā)送觸發(fā)信號和作業(yè)切換信號,接收到工控機信號的相機開始采集圖片并執(zhí)行各界面的檢測程序,相機再將各界面的檢測結(jié)果傳回工控機。
工控機(如圖3所示)有實現(xiàn)整個系統(tǒng)的運動控制部分功能,具體如下:檢測被測件到位信號;供電控制;聲光報警器控制;上位機通信光源控制及相機控制。
3.1.2 顯示器
顯示器的作用是為了便于檢測員查看實時生成的檢測報告,觀察并手動處理相關(guān)區(qū)域或調(diào)整工件姿態(tài)而設(shè)。
3.2.1 功能概述
當(dāng)車輛到達(dá)檢查工位時,攝像頭對整車(檢查區(qū)域)進(jìn)行拍照,并對該區(qū)域的待檢項目進(jìn)行圖片分割、提取。
車輛到待檢查工位時,視覺系統(tǒng)獲取這個車上待檢零件的配置信息,調(diào)取信息庫中的圖片信息。
通過信息庫中圖片信息與分割提取的圖片進(jìn)行比對,正確項與不正確項分別用綠框和紅框同步顯示在工位邊的顯示器上。
檢測完畢后,生成和存儲外觀檢測報告,并存儲相關(guān)圖片供以后檢查調(diào)用。
3.2.2 工件測試圖庫管理
測試完成后,自動根據(jù)工件ID建立工件檔案,并將相關(guān)測試圖片存儲在特定位置,針對每一項檢測內(nèi)容,建立相應(yīng)的文件路徑,方便用戶隨時查看與統(tǒng)計。
3.2.3 工件測試結(jié)果的統(tǒng)計分析
隨著該光學(xué)測試平臺對不同工件的測試積累,用戶可以針對每項檢測內(nèi)容進(jìn)行統(tǒng)計分析,列出較為多發(fā)的“不合格項”以及“瑕疵項”,為人工復(fù)檢提供檢測重點。根據(jù)測試結(jié)果文件,對測試結(jié)果進(jìn)行統(tǒng)計,供生產(chǎn)管理參考使用。
3.2.4 用戶管理
不同用戶具有不同的操作權(quán)限,管理員可以設(shè)置和增加操作員的權(quán)限,非管理員只能更改自己的權(quán)限,非管理權(quán)限不能對測試序列的編輯及設(shè)備相關(guān)參數(shù)進(jìn)行更改。運維用戶可以在軟件中管理門戶,對軟件設(shè)置、權(quán)限和數(shù)據(jù)庫進(jìn)行維護(hù)。負(fù)責(zé)算法開發(fā)的人員,可以使用遠(yuǎn)程部署的應(yīng)用工具訪問標(biāo)準(zhǔn)庫中的原始數(shù)據(jù),通過代碼對原始數(shù)據(jù)進(jìn)行分析,并形成優(yōu)化的分析算法。
3.2.5 軟件測試執(zhí)行
測試執(zhí)行界面顯示測試項結(jié)果,測試產(chǎn)品圖片、測試人員、測試時間、測試執(zhí)行的序列版本、設(shè)備系統(tǒng)狀態(tài),如設(shè)備故障要有明顯的提示。
3.3.1 視覺相機
視覺相機可以有效覆蓋整車的所有細(xì)節(jié)。同時相機通過以太網(wǎng)通信協(xié)議與工控機之間進(jìn)行通信。
3.3.2 輔助光源
由于整車尺寸較大,為了保障良好的照明效果和均勻性,采用定制光源(含條形光源及面陣光源),光源與金屬結(jié)構(gòu)通過專用夾具固定。通過調(diào)節(jié)發(fā)光尺寸、位置及發(fā)散角,優(yōu)化整車照明效果。
機械結(jié)構(gòu)是采用型鋼材料,搭建一個類似于燈廊的結(jié)構(gòu)。左右上三個方面布置視覺鏡頭、輔助光源、安全光柵及檢測開關(guān)等,其作用是為視覺檢查系統(tǒng)搭建架構(gòu),實現(xiàn)電器件安裝。
該系統(tǒng)網(wǎng)絡(luò)結(jié)構(gòu)如圖4所示。
MES系統(tǒng)作為上層網(wǎng)絡(luò)系統(tǒng),通過交換機向該系統(tǒng)傳遞車輛配置差異信息;控制系統(tǒng)下達(dá)指令到光源控制器、運動單元控制器及相機陣列;運動單元控制器控制相機支架根據(jù)車輛位置調(diào)整相機姿態(tài);光源控制器結(jié)合環(huán)境因素判斷是否對檢查車輛進(jìn)行補光;相機拍攝后,信號傳遞服務(wù)器進(jìn)行數(shù)據(jù)處理、對比等計算后,通過控制器傳遞給工位顯示系統(tǒng)。
圖5是應(yīng)用示例,整車外觀配置錯漏裝檢查側(cè)重于對后視鏡、外飾件、輪輞型號、輪胎型號、制動卡鉗型號等檢查,圖中所示是對后視鏡、輪胎等檢查的一個案例展示。
本系統(tǒng)基于機器視覺的智能光學(xué)檢測平臺,利用光電技術(shù)、機器視覺、圖像處理、運動控制等技術(shù),實現(xiàn)整車外觀多類指標(biāo)與配置的實時檢測與評估。測試平臺主要由傳感器模塊、光源照明模塊、機器視覺模塊、工控機模塊、圖像處理模塊和軟件系統(tǒng)構(gòu)成。待檢車輛傳送至檢查工位時,傳感器發(fā)送信號至工控機,然后對外觀特定區(qū)域拍照。同時,智能檢查設(shè)備自動讀取識別車輛配置信息,然后對配置差異件的拍照、數(shù)據(jù)庫比對、合格或不合格判斷、結(jié)果展示等實現(xiàn)整車配置智能檢查。
本系統(tǒng)基于機器視覺的自動化檢測平臺,可以實現(xiàn)整個檢測流程的全智能化、自動化,以達(dá)到減少手動操作、提高測試可靠性與穩(wěn)定性的目的,從而提高生產(chǎn)效率。